Before you put hard-earned dosh into a new model, I would try mixing your e-juice with vegetable glycerine. I do it in an empty e-juice squeazy bottle. You should get more vape, which you say you don't get much of, and less hit - with any luck.

It has another benefit: You can buy ultra-high nicotine juice at the same price as your regular and make it go further with the cheap glycerine :)
